Santa Barbara, CA � June 14, 2010 � Top luxury hotels and meeting professionals from around the country came together to do business, sample new cutting-edge technology, and confirm the advent of brighter days for the meetings industry at the Elite Meetings Alliance (EMA)?Elite Meetings International�s (EMI) three-day event that brings together prequalified corporate and association meeting professionals with leaders in the hospitality industry. 

Taking place at Terranea Resort in Rancho Palos Verdes, CA, May 16-18, 2010, the EMA included more than 1,200 prescheduled one-on-one meetings, continuing educational sessions for CMP credit, great speakers, and unique networking events. 

�The verdict is in, the Spring 2010 EMA was the best yet,� says Kelly Foy, Chief Executive Officer of Elite Meetings. �With close to 100 top hotels and 100 qualified planners in attendance, it is clear that corporate and association meetings are back to stay � and our event helped stoke the progress. I cannot imagine a more productive three days, in a more conducive environment, than what we experienced at the wonderful Terranea Resort.� 

Those who attended, share the same sentiment. �I was sad to leave... I was so impressed with this event, your staff, the quality of properties... and much more,� says Steven King, a meeting professional representing The Oxford Club, �I'm already signing a contract with a hotelier I met [at the EMA], and I'm also a couple weeks away from signing a second contract with another hotelier I met. It really was a terrific event.� And King isn�t alone�100% of the planners surveyed after the EMA expect to book business with attending hotels.

The Fall 2010 Elite Meetings Alliance will be held at the Kingsmill Resort & Spa in Williamsburg, VA, from October 3-5, 2010. For more information, visit www.EliteMeetingsAlliance.com.

EMI Technology Powers Business 

Dozens of EMA attendees had the chance to participate in hands-on demonstrations of two of EMI�s cutting-edge technologies: SpeedRFP� and FaceTime� Appointment Scheduler.

SpeedRFP, a new product for creating, submitting, and tracking RFPs online, launched in April of this year and is already generating RFPs for meetings planners and hotels in the U.S. and internationally. As SpeedRFP gains adoption, planner input continues to be gathered to shape the tool into a game-changer for the industry. SpeedRFP is a completely portable and seamless RFP technology that is fully APEX-compliant. Free to meeting professionals?from whom it is already drawing enthusiastic support?any hotel can download the Community Edition at no charge as well.

EMI�s FaceTime� Appointment Scheduler technology is a proprietary streamlined program which helps buyers and sellers request, create, and manage appointments at meetings and conventions. Used widely at industry trade shows including the 2009 ITME/Motivation Show and Meeting Professional International�s (MPI) MeetDifferent 2010, FaceTime facilitated the confirmation of more than 1,200 face-to-face business meetings at the Spring 2010 EMA.

The FaceTime� Appointment Scheduler technology will be utilized to bring planners and hotels together at hosted buyer programs at MPI�s World Education Congress (WEC) in Vancouver this summer; and at the ITME/Motivation Show in Chicago in the fall. This marks the second year that FaceTime will power hosted buyer programs for each of these esteemed organizations.

Education and Community Responsibility

Speakers at the Spring 2010 EMA included Dianne Budion-Devitt of The DND Group, Inc., speaking on how to �Reinvent With Passion.� Budion-Devitt is an assistant professor at New York University�s Preston Robert Tisch School of Hospitality, Tourism and Sports Marketing, as well as president of New York�s chapter of Meeting Professionals International. 

Also featured was Midori Connolly, CEO of Pulse Staging & Events, Inc. Connolly authored the first-ever set of guidelines for Green AV Staging, and is a trusted resource in audiovisual support for hybrid meeting design, production, and execution for clients such as BMW and PCMA; she spoke about �Beyond Water Bottles: the Business of Green Meetings.� 

Another industry speaker was Jeanette Nyden, J.D., a former Assistant Public Defender and bankruptcy litigator, who founded J. Nyden & Company in 2003 to teach the art of negotiation. Nyden addressed �How to Strike a Better Deal: Balancing Your Need for a Fair Price with Your Need for a Good Vendor Relationship.�

Additionally, EMA participants had the opportunity to give back through an organized corporate responsibility activity at the Marine Mammal Care Center at Fort MacArthur, CA. The Marine Mammal Care Center?a hospital for ill, injured, and orphaned marine mammals?focuses on the treatment and release of rescued California sea lions, northern elephant seals, harbor seals, and northern fur seals. 

About the Elite Meetings Alliance (EMA)
The EMA is a three-day, invitation-only event that brings together prequalified corporate and association planners with leaders in the luxury hotel industry to cultivate relationships and build business. Featured are private, personalized business development meetings, continuing educational breakout sessions for CMP credit, and unique networking activities. The next EMA will be hosted at Kingsmill Resort & Spa in Williamsburg, VA, October 3-5, 2010.

About Elite Meetings International
Based in Santa Barbara, Elite Meetings International (EMI) provides integrated solutions to enhance the performance of meeting and hospitality professionals. EMI supports this community through a combination of innovative technology, direct sales support, customized marketing programs and face-to-face business-building events. Additionally, www.EliteMeetings.com serves as a commission-free RFP-generating tool and a comprehensive vehicle for sourcing luxury, upper-upscale, and upscale properties. EMI�s innovations include FaceTime� (www.FaceTimeScheduler.com), a widely used program for helping buyers and sellers � across any industry � identify synergies, manage appointments, and make direct connections with one another; and SpeedRFP� (www.SpeedRFP.com), a new time-saving product for creating, submitting, and managing RFPs online.
